What Really Counts as an HVAC Emergency?

Some problems can wait. Others can't. We consider an HVAC emergency any situation where your health, safety, or property is at immediate risk. Here are the big ones:

  • No Heat in Freezing Weather: If your furnace quits during a cold snap, especially with kids or elderly family members at home, that's an emergency.
  • AC Failure During Extreme Heat: When the Texas sun is blazing and your AC stops cooling, it's more than uncomfortable—it's dangerous.
  • Gas Smells or Suspected Carbon Monoxide: If you smell natural gas or your CO alarm is sounding, leave the house immediately and call for help.
  • Electrical Burning Smells: A burning smell from your furnace or AC unit could mean an electrical fire is starting.
  • Major Water Leaks: If your indoor AC unit is leaking a lot of water, it can cause serious damage to your floors and walls.

How Harper's Climate Tests Your HVAC System

Our local weather puts a real strain on heating and cooling equipment. The intense summer heat forces AC units to run almost non-stop for months, wearing down motors and capacitors. Our hard water can also lead to mineral buildup in condensate lines, causing clogs and indoor leaks. In older homes around downtown Harper or out in the ranchlands, we often see aging gas furnaces that need careful monitoring for safe operation. Newer homes in developments might have more modern heat pumps, which are great for our milder winters but still need regular check-ups.

Common HVAC Problems We See in Harper

Just last week, we got a call from a homeowner off Ranch Road 12 whose AC had stopped blowing cold air. The culprit? A clogged condensate line from algae buildup—a common issue with our humidity. Another time, a family in a older stone house called because their furnace wouldn't ignite on a cold morning. A faulty flame sensor was the issue, a simple fix but crucial for heat. Other frequent calls include frozen AC coils, failing capacitors that prevent the compressor from starting, and thermostat malfunctions that leave you guessing at the temperature.

HVAC Service Cost Breakdown for Harper

We believe in clear, upfront pricing. Most HVAC service calls start with a standard diagnostic fee, which typically ranges from $75 to $125 in our area. This covers the technician's time to identify the problem. If you need emergency service outside normal business hours, there is usually an after-hours call-out fee, often 1.5 to 2 times the standard rate. Labor is then billed by the hour, plus the cost of any parts. For example, a common repair like replacing a capacitor on a hot summer afternoon might cost between $200 and $400 total. A more complex job, like fixing a refrigerant leak and recharging the system, will be more. We always provide a detailed estimate before any work begins.

What to Do While Waiting for Help (Safety Checklist)

  • Gas Smell: Evacuate everyone immediately. Do not turn lights on or off. Call your gas utility from outside, then call us.
  • CO Alarm: Leave the house immediately and call for help from fresh air.
  • If it is safe to do so, turn off the HVAC system at the thermostat.
  • Keep everyone, especially children, away from the malfunctioning equipment.
  • Move infants, elderly family, or anyone with health issues to a comfortable neighbor's house if possible.
  • Never attempt to repair gas lines or high-voltage electrical components yourself.

Local Codes and Why Licensed Service Matters in Harper

In Texas, HVAC work must be done by licensed technicians. This isn't just red tape—it's for your safety. Proper furnace venting is critical to prevent carbon monoxide poisoning. Handling refrigerant requires an EPA Section 608 certification to protect the environment. And if you're replacing a full system, our local building codes may require a permit to ensure it's done right. Using a licensed company like ours means the job meets all these standards.
